Writer at large, Christina Pickard sat down with Maureen Downey, to discuss the latest on one of the largest wine fraud cases in modern history. In 2013, Rudy Kurniawan was sentenced to 10 years in prison for selling millions of dollars in fake rare vintages. For the full back story, check out Wine Enthusiast’s true crime podcast, Vinfamous.
